About the Awards:
Each year since 2003 the Public Benefit
Flying Awards have been presented in a ceremony in the
United States Capitol Building.
The National Aeronautic Association (NAA) traces its roots to the Aero Club
of America, founded in 1905. Since its beginning, NAA's primary mission
has been the advancement of the art, sport, and science of aviation in the
United States, including space flight. Through its annual national awards
program, NAA "celebrates the past," while at the same time recognizing
the achievements of those who are developing technology and "inventing the
future."
The NAA is famous for a number of nationally prominent awards that have been
given since early in the history of flight, such as the Robert J. Collier
Trophy, the Wright Brothers Memorial Trophy, the Frank G. Brewer award for
aviation education, and the Elder Statesmen of Aviation awards.
NAA's first awards for Public Benefit Flying were presented on September 10,
2003, celebrating the service and accomplishments of the many volunteers in
aviation who "fly to help others," performing missions of community
and individual service. These awards were developed by NAA in association with
the Air Care Alliance. More than thirty nominations were received in 2003 and a
similar number in 2004.
The awards have been divided into five categories:
Distinguished Volunteer Pilot
Distinguished Volunteer
Outstanding Achievement in Advancement of Public Benefit Flying
Public Benefit Flying Teamwork Award
Champion of Public Benefit Flying
The annual awards were presented in ceremonial rooms on the Senate side of the
Nation's Capitol Building, with additional awards presented at other venues.
